To genuinely comprehend the vital role these skilled tradespeople play, one need to appreciate the unique tiers of electrical licensing within this nation. While a basic electrician can deal with a vast variety of domestic and commercial electrical wiring, installation, and repair work tasks within a property, their scope normally ends at the point of supply-- that is, where the power enters the facilities from the street. This is precisely where the Level 2 electrician steps in, bridging the gap between the circulation network and the customer.

Their duties are substantial and incorporate a series of highly specialized jobs that require advanced training and particular accreditation from network company. Photo a brand-new home being built; it's the Level 2 professional who connects that residential or commercial property to the overhead or underground power lines, installing the service fuse, meter panel, and typically the important earthing system. They are the ones who literally bring the power to your doorstep.

Think about also the scenario of a power interruption. While the general public may assume the issue lies solely with the main grid, often the problem is within the service line linking an individual residential or commercial property. Here, a Level 2 specialist is dispatched to identify and remedy the fault, whether it's a broken aerial service cable, an issue with the point of attachment to your home, or a problem with the metering equipment. Their ability to work on live service mains, often at heights or in confined areas, underscores the fundamental threats and the rigorous safety protocols they need to follow.

Beyond brand-new connections and fault finding, these specialists are consistently associated with updating existing electrical facilities. As households require more power for air conditioning, electrical cars, and a plethora of contemporary home appliances, the need for service upgrades becomes critical. A Level 2 electrician evaluates the current capability, figures out the required upgrades to the service mains and metering, and after that meticulously performs the work, ensuring the increased load can be securely and dependably delivered. This frequently involves changing outdated cable televisions, updating switchboards, and setting up wise meters that offer greater control and performance to customers.

In addition, these specialized sparkies are instrumental in the rollout of renewable resource services. When someone decides to install photovoltaic panels on their roof, it's a Level 2 electrician who handles the vital connection of that solar array to the grid. This involves setting up the essential isolation switches, making sure compliance with network policies, and integrating the solar inverter system with the existing electrical facilities. Their operate in this area is important for the country's shift towards a more sustainable energy future.

The journey to ending up being a Level 2 electrician is a testimony to commitment and continuous learning. It typically begins with a standard electrical apprenticeship, followed by years of practical experience. However, to attain Level 2 accreditation, even more specialized training is compulsory. This training covers sophisticated subjects such as overhead and underground service work, metering requirements, network security rules, and fault location strategies. These courses are typically provided by registered training organisations and backed by the numerous electrical energy distributors throughout the land. The evaluations are rigorous, guaranteeing that only those with an extensive understanding of the complicated electrical network are approved the authority to operate at this vital level.

The obligations do not end with technical proficiency. Level 2 electricians should also have an extensive understanding of pertinent security guidelines and codes of practice. They are the frontline guardians of electrical safety, not just for their own well-being but for the general public they serve. Every connection, every repair work, and every upgrade should follow the strictest security requirements to prevent mishaps, fires, and electrocution. Their work is regularly checked, and their licenses are subject to continuous evaluation, ensuring continued proficiency and compliance.
